About The Role
JOB SUMMARY
We are looking for two motivated, fresh-graduate engineers to join our AI Innovation Lab, working closely with our Cybersecurity Lab. You will initially support the build-out of a governance and audit-evidence control plane for AI agents operating across APAC — a rare opportunity to work at the intersection of AI engineering, security, and regulatory compliance. You will help translate real data-privacy law (Philippines, Australia, Singapore) into working policy logic that governs what autonomous AI agents are allowed to do with data, and produce the audit trail a regulator would expect to see. You will work closely with the AI Innovation Lab Lead and the Cybersecurity Lab to research the problem space and build a working prototype from the ground up. As this is a Lab-wide role, you may be assigned to other AI Innovation Lab initiatives as projects evolve.
JOB RESPONSIBILITIES
- Read sections of real data-privacy laws (e.g. Philippines Data Privacy Act, Australian Privacy Act, Singapore PDPA) and help turn them into clear "if this, then that" rules our system can follow. Example: "If a Philippine customer's health data is about to be sent to a server outside the Philippines, block it unless we have documented consent on file."
- Look into what existing privacy-compliance and AI-agent security tools currently do, and write up clearly what they do and don't cover. Example: a one-page note answering "does this specific tool stop an AI agent from sending sensitive data overseas in real time, or does it just log the fact afterward?"
- Help build parts of the policy engine — the part of the system that decides whether an AI agent's action should be allowed, blocked, redacted, or rerouted based on the jurisdiction of the data involved. Example: writing the code that checks an incoming data request against a rule and returns a decision like BLOCK or ALLOW.
- Support development of the residency-routing logic that keeps data subject to a localisation rule processed and logged within the correct jurisdictional perimeter. Example: making sure a request involving an Australian customer's data is routed to, and logged in, an Australia-based path rather than a shared/default one.
- Build the logging system that records every decision the policy engine makes, in a format a compliance officer could read and understand later. Example: a log entry showing what agent made the request, what data was involved, what was decided, and which rule was cited.
- Connect the policy engine to other systems (e.g. MCP servers, AI agent platforms) so it can see and act on real requests, not just test data. Example: writing the small connector code that lets an AI tool send a request to our policy engine and receive a decision back.
- Help build a simple dashboard where a compliance team member can view agent activity and download reports. Example: a table showing Date | Agent | Action | Decision | Rule Cited, with a button to export it.
- Write clean, tested code and participate in code review, working alongside senior engineers who will guide overall system design.
- Write clear notes about what you researched, built, or decided, so a teammate (or future you) can understand it without redoing the work. Example: a short weekly note — what you researched or built, what you concluded, and what's still unclear.
- Meet regularly with senior engineers and the AI Lab Lead to share progress and raise anything that's blocking you. Example: a 15-minute daily check-in covering what you finished, what's next, and where you're stuck.
- Support the team through the prototype phase, with an eye toward hardening the system for real design-partner deployments as the project matures.
